The HR Risk & Associate Relations Director is a strategic leadership role responsible for protecting the organization’s talent and reputation by proactively managing HR compliance, risk, fraud, and associate relations. This role advances business priorities by cultivating a culture of integrity, trust, and accountability. Reporting directly to the Chief Human Resources Officer, this leader partners across the enterprise to translate regulatory requirements, employment law, and workplace practices into value-adding strategies that reduce risk, strengthen culture, and enhance business resilience.

Key Responsibilities

Strategic Leadership

  • Design and execute a comprehensive HR risk and associate relations strategy aligned with organizational values and long-term growth objectives.
  • Serve as a trusted advisor to senior leadership, offering insights that link risk mitigation and associate relations to improved business performance and associate engagement.
  • Lead enterprise-wide efforts to shape a consistent, high-integrity associate experience across business units and geographies.

HR Risk Management

  • Oversee a proactive HR risk management framework that identifies, mitigates, and monitors risks across the associate lifecycle (e.g., hiring, performance management, separation).
  • Partner with Legal, Audit, Compliance, and business leaders to assess emerging risks and design practical solutions.
  • Lead sensitive internal investigations with integrity, consistency, and discretion, ensuring appropriate action plans and root cause resolution.
  • Establish enterprise risk dashboards to inform HR and executive leadership on key trends, insights, and corrective actions.

Associate Relations Leadership

  • Set the strategic direction for associate relations, focusing on preventive practices, trend analysis, and scalable investigation and resolution frameworks.
  • Lead a high-performing team of associate relations professionals, fostering capability-building and a service mindset.
  • Act as an executive-level escalation point for complex, high-risk associate matters requiring nuanced judgment.
  • Promote a speak-up culture by designing accessible, trusted channels for associate feedback and concerns.

Policy Governance and Capability Building

  • Oversee development, governance, and communication of HR policies that drive fairness, transparency, and compliance.
  • Partner with Legal to ensure timely integration of new regulatory requirements into policy and practice.
  • Deliver enterprise-wide training and leadership briefings on workplace ethics, policy updates, and risk awareness.
  • Facilitate culture-building workshops that reinforce expected behaviors and values.

Analytics, Reporting & Executive Communication

  • Develop a data-informed reporting strategy that tracks key HR risk and associate relations metrics aligned to business outcomes.
  • Maintain accurate documentation and case tracking to ensure legal compliance, trend visibility, and internal accountability.
  • Present actionable insights to executive and board-level stakeholders to inform strategic decisions and culture health.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ources, Employment Law, Business Administration, or a related field. Master’s degree or professional HR certification (e.g., SHRM-SCP, SPHR) preferred.
  • Minimum of 6–8 years of progressive experience in HR compliance, associate relations, or employment law.
  • Demonstrated ability to lead strategic risk and associate relations initiatives that drive organizational impact.
  • Advanced knowledge of U.S. employment laws and workplace investigations; global exposure a plus.
  • Skilled in leveraging data, technology, and systems (HRIS, case management tools) to optimize risk mitigation efforts.
  • Strong executive communication, facilitation, and consultative skills with the ability to influence at all levels of the organization.

First Horizon Corporation is a leading regional financial services company, dedicated to helping our clients, communities and associates unlock their full potential with capital and counsel. Headquartered in Memphis, TN, the banking subsidiary First Horizon Bank operates in 12 states across the southern U.S. The Company and its subsidiaries offer commercial, private banking, consumer, small business, wealth and trust management, retail brokerage, capital markets, fixed income, and mortgage banking services.
